Character Name: Vadim Grassi

Please provide a short backstory for this character, approximately 2 paragraphs

Vadim was born to an impoverished family in D'sa'ral shortly before first contact with humanity was made, where his immediate family served the nobility in their fortified dwellings for the most part. Early into their childhood, the tajaran uprisings took place, with most of the Grassi clan siding with the rebel forces, Vadim was left in a dangerous position. Shortly after the first riots took place, he was sent to live at an inn owned by extended family in a more rural area while the conflict blew over.

Following the end of the revolution, despite the rebel victory, nearly all of the Grassi family had been killed, leaving him with little future on his homeworld.

For the next odd thirty years, he took to remaining within the outskirts of D'sa'ral, taking possession of the property that had been his home once the rest of his family died off. Eventually, he came to accept that his future on Ahdomai was limited.

After selling off what heirlooms and property left to his family, he set off to leave Ahdomai behind, and retreat back onto the fringes of Tau Ceti, looking to take advantage of a lifestyle that living alongside humanity may provide.
